Courage Project's Founder

 

Megan Raphael founded Courage Project in 2003.

She is a public speaker, certified professional life coach, writer, and award-winning author.

She is also a wife, mother, aunt, and sister.

She is a hospice volunteer, and mentor to high school girls through Young Women for Change.

Why Her Driving Passion for Courage?

After working for many years as a manager, consultant, workshop leader, and coach she came to see how hard it is for people to live in create lives of their own choosing and live in accordance with their deepest values. She saw how difficult it was for them to believe in themselves.

While writing her book, The Courage Code,she heard over and over again from women she was interviewing how rarely they honor their courage. All too often, we, as women, are comparing ourselves to other people or to media messages telling us we're not quite enough - not smart enough, beautiful enough, not courageous enough. As a result, we de-value who we are and what we have to offer the world.

Megan started Courage Project with the commitment to support every person in creating the life they've always imagined. Her dream is to inspire all women and men to love and accept themselves so they are free to love and accept others in the world. Her goal is to help people live in alignment with their values.

Her mission is to teach people how to find their courage for being and doing what they dream of!
